Topic Dog Boards / Showing / CKCS nose turned brown
- By luvhandles Date 14.03.06 21:32 UTC
Hi, I don't know if I've posted in the right section but Harvey's nose has started to turn brown. Up until about 3 weeks ago it was pure black as were his paddy paws which also seem to be turning brown. He is ruby coloured and just wondered if this is normal?

Hayley
- By Moonmaiden Date 14.03.06 22:12 UTC
It can be especially in winter or if the bloodlines have dogs with poor pigment in it

You can give liquid Elderberry & Nettle Extract which helps some dogs
- By LucyD [gb] Date 15.03.06 06:39 UTC
Yep, winter nose - blenheims and rubies suffer from it frequently! I've heard Kelp tablets can also help. Sardines etc are also a good source of vitamin D, which I understand is part of the problem - anyone got any views on whether that can help? Or other things? :-)
- By HipandHop [gb] Date 15.03.06 10:42 UTC
Yes vitamin D is very good, I have a girl at present with a  winters nose and she usually gets it before her season, she tends to keep it for at least 3 months in some cases. It eventually blackens but do try the vitamin D :-) this can help shorten the length of time. :-)
